EDDINGTON – George Philip Kelley, 69, died May 6, 2007, at his home. He was born March 1, 1938, in Eddington, the son of Howard G. and Stella M. (Kerr) Kelley. George was employed with Eastern Fine Paper Co. He was a member of Rising Virtue Lodge No. 10 AF & AM, Scottish Rite Bodies Valley of Bangor and Anah Shriners. He was also a member of the Fraternal Order of Eagles Club No. 3177, Brewer and the National Rifle Association. Surviving are two sisters, Lucille Dexter and Charlene Bowden, both of Eddington; and one aunt, Louise Robertson of Eddington, several nieces and nephews.
